>>124755896
True, but
Sapphire (Greek: σάπφειρος; sappheiros, 'blue stone',[2] which probably referred instead at the time to lapis lazuli) is a typically blue gemstone variety of the mineral corundum, an aluminium oxide

>>124757316
Japanese only has proper adjectivial forms (read: い adjectives) for the four primary colors. White (白い), black (黒い), red (赤い) and blue (青い). These are also the only ones with the 真っ prefix forms (meaning "pure/deep"; eg 真っ白, means "pure white"). Every other color is by analogy for the most part, with a noun+色 ("color"); eg, 灰色 ("ash-colored"), means gray, 桃色 ("peach blossom colored") means pink, etc. There's a couple of weird exceptions, like 緑 ("green") and 紫 ("violet") are の adjectives that don't have to take the 色 suffix; same with loan words like オレンジ ("orange"). But the language does contain these words; they're just in a more roundabout form than a simple adjective like the four primary colors.
